Abstract
Trihaloallyl and trihaloacryl derivatives were synthesized for wood preservative evaluation. It was shown in bioassays that the presence of iodine in the compounds is important for antifungal activity. Among the compounds tested, triiodo-and monobromodiiodo-allyl esters and -acryl esters were found to possess marked protective action to wood molds and wood decay fungi. 3-Ethoxycarbonyloxy-l-bromo-1,2-diiodopropene was chosen as the most promising potential wood preservative as it also showed insecticidal activity. -- AATA
